The word problem is: Kathleen and Cade leave simultaneously from the same point hiking in opposite directions, Kathleen walking at 4mph and Cade at 5mph. How long can they talk on their walkie-talkies if the walkie-talkies have a 20 mile radius???
Answer by stanbon(75887) (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
Kathleen and Cade leave simultaneously from the same point hiking in opposite directions, Kathleen walking at 4mph and Cade at 5mph.
How long can they talk on their walkie-talkies if the walkie-talkies have a 20 mile radius???
----
Kathy DATA:
rate = 4 mph ; time = x hrs ; distance = 4x miles
----
Cade DATA:
rate = 5 mph ; time = x hrs; distance = 5x miles
----
Equation:
dist + dist = 20 miles
4x + 5x = 20
9x 20
x = 2.22 hrs = 2hr 13.2 minutes
------
That's how long they can talk.
